Real Madrid bid to sign Mbappe from PSG

Real Madrid bid to sign Mbappe from PSG

By Naveel Krishant
25/08/2021
Kylian Mbappe on attack for PSG. [image: 90min.com]

Real Madrid have made a 137 million pounds bid to sign Kylian Mbappe from Paris Saint-Germain.

Sky Sports reports that Madrid made the offer on Sunday and PSG are yet to respond to their proposal.

Mbappe is out of contract next summer and he has so far refused to sign a new deal, despite PSG's attempts to get the France international to commit his future to the club.

The 22-year-old has told PSG that his dream is to play for Real Madrid, who have been linked with a move for the World Cup winner throughout the summer transfer window.
